What is a Dry Sump, and what is a Wet Sump?
The difference between a Wet Sump and Dry Sump oil system is that a Wet Sump is what you have in your car. The oil pools at the bottom of a pan and a pump moves the oil from pool all the way through the engine. A dry sump makes the oil return to a reservoir by scavenger pumps. Oil gets pumped to the engine bearings by a pressure pump. This system has a dual oil pumps.
